VITE_OPEN === 'true' }, // 其他配置... }; }); 重启Vite 开发服务器以使环境变量生效: 每次修改 .env 文件后,需要重启 Vite 开发服务器以使新的环境变量生效。 在Vue3 代码中通过 import.meta.env 访问环境变量: 在Vue 3 组件或其他 JavaScript 文件中,可以通过 import.meta.env 对象访问定义...
"dev": "vite --mode dev", // 取 .env.dev文件中的配置 "pro": "vite --mode pro", // 取 .env.pro文件中的配置 "build": "vue-tsc --noEmit && vite build", //未指定默认取.env中的配置 "build:dev": "vue-tsc --noEmit && vite build --mode dev", // build的时候取dev的配置 ...
// 取 .env.dev文件中的配置"pro":"vite --mode pro",// 取 .env.pro文件中的配置"build":"vue-tsc --noEmit && vite build",//未指定默认取.env中的配置"build:dev":"vue-tsc --noEmit && vite build --mode dev",// build的时候取dev的配置"build:pro":"vue-tsc --noEmit && vite build...
第一:为项目根目录开发、测试、生成(也可以加入预发布)环境创建.env文件 .env.development .env.production .env.test 第二:配置数据 # 变量必须以 VITE_ 为前缀才能暴露给外部读取 NODE_ENV='development'VITE_APP_BASE_API='/dev-api' NODE_ENV ='production'VITE_APP_BASE_API='/prod-api' # 变量必须...
1.环境变量前缀:在 Vite 的世界里,环境变量就像是明星,需要特定的前缀才能闪亮登场。所有的环境变量必须以 VITE_ 前缀开头,这不仅是 Vite 的安全措施,还能确保只有那些经过精心挑选并明确暴露给客户端的变量才能被访问。这样,你的隐秘信息将不会被误用或滥用。2.环境文件的优先级:在多环境配置中,.env 文件...
一、环境变量配置 官网https://cn.vitejs.dev/guide/env-and-mode.html#intellisense 1. 新建.env开头的文件在根目录 为了防止意外地将一些环境变量泄漏到客户端,只有以VITE_为前缀的变量才会暴露给经过vite处理的代码 .env所有环境默认加载 .env.development开发模式默认加载 ...
{ "scripts": { "dev": "vite", "build": "vue-tsc && vite build", "preview": "vite preview" }} 在开发过程中,我们可以运行npm run dev启动开发服务器。它会加载.env.development文件中的环境变量。当你准备构建生产包时,运行npm run build命令。它会加载.env.production文件中的环...
项目封装axios、vite使用env环境变量主要是统一代码规范,便于开发且后续好维护。 💖 编码sliod原则 SOLID 原则是一种设计原则,用于指导编写可维护、可扩展、易于理解和可复用的代码。 单一职责原则 (Single Responsibility Principle, SRP): 一个类或模块只负责一项职责,降低耦合度。
一、获取默认环境变量 vite 默认的 5 个内置环境变量无法在 .env.development 等配置文件中更改,可以通过运行时配置更改 console.log(import.meta.env);// {// BASE_URL: '/',// DEV: true,// MODE: 'development',// PROD: false,// SSR: false// } ...
全局环境.env文件 可以配置全局属性 # port 端口号 VITE_PORT= 8888# open 运行 npm run dev 时自动打开浏览器 VITE_OPEN=false# public path 配置线上环境路径(打包)、本地通过 http-server 访问时,请置空即可 VITE_PUBLIC_PATH= /vue-next-admin-preview/ ...